What is the diagnosis code for eye exam?

Oct 01, 2021 · Z01.00 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. Short description: Encounter for exam of eyes and vision w/o abnormal findings. The 2022 edition of ICD-10-CM Z01.00 became effective on October 1, …

What is the CPT code for a routine eye exam?

Comprehensive eye examination codes (92004, 92014) describe a general evaluation of the complete visual system. The CPT defines it as: "... includes history, general medical observation, external and ophthalmoscopic examinations, gross visual fields and basic sensorimotor examination.

What is CPT code S0621?

S0621 Routine ophthalmological examination including refraction; established patient.

What is the difference between CPT code 92002 and 92004?

92002. Ophthalmological services: Medical examination and evaluation with initiation of diagnostic treatment program; intermediate, new patient. 92004. Ophthalmological services: Medical examination and evaluation with initiation of diagnostic treatment program; comprehensive, new patient, one or more visits.Nov 15, 2017

What is the ICD-10 code for each type of diabetes?

In ICD-10-CM, chapter 4, “Endocrine, nutritional and metabolic diseases (E00-E89),” includes a separate subchapter (block), Diabetes mellitus E08-E13, with the categories: E08, Diabetes mellitus due to underlying condition. E09, Drug or chemical induced diabetes mellitus. E10, Type 1 diabetes mellitus.

What is the difference between CPT code 92012 and 92014?

Code 92012 is closest to 99213 (low to moderate MDM) and 92014 is closest to 99214 (moderate to high MDM). These services require that the patient needs and receives care for a condition other than refractive error.

What does CPT code 92015 mean?

refraction CPT 92015 describes refraction and any necessary prescription of lenses. Refraction is not separately reimbursed as part of a routine eye exam or as part of a medical examination and evaluation with treatment/diagnostic program.

When do you use E11 8?

You would use E11. 8 when the diagnosis documented is listed in the alpha under key word diabetes then with and then it states E11. 8. Or the provider specifically links a diagnosis to the diabetes and there is no specific diabetes complaint cation code for the pairing.
